Global Anemometer Market size was valued at USD 1.05 Billion in 2024 and is poised to grow from USD 1.1 Billion in 2025 to USD 1.64 Billion by 2033, growing at a CAGR of 5.1% during the forecast period (2026-2033).
The global anemometer market focuses on devices essential for measuring wind speed and direction, serving key industries such as meteorology, aviation, renewable energy, and industrial safety. The increasing demand for precise atmospheric data plays a crucial role in optimizing turbine performance, enhancing flight planning, and reducing weather-related risks. Previously dominated by mechanical cup-type sensors, the market has evolved significantly with the introduction of ultrasonic and laser-based models, facilitating widespread adoption in various sectors. This transition is driven by the growth of renewable energy, with developers implementing sensor networks to improve site assessments and boost output efficiency. Furthermore, AI integration enhances predictive capabilities, enabling advanced algorithms for real-time wind profiling, ensuring higher reliability and encouraging innovations in the anemometer sector.

Driver of the Global Anemometer Market
The increasing development of renewable energy initiatives, especially wind farms, generates a continual demand for accurate measurements of wind speed and direction. This necessity drives utilities and developers to invest in sophisticated anemometer technologies that perform effectively across various atmospheric conditions. As the customer base for these instruments expands, manufacturers are motivated to innovate, further strengthening market growth through enhanced product adoption. Additionally, there is a consistent need for system integration and maintenance services within the industry, which bolsters regional and global supply chains and contributes to the long-term resilience of the anemometer market as a whole.
Restraints in the Global Anemometer Market
The significant initial costs associated with purchasing and installing advanced anemometer systems can create financial obstacles for numerous potential buyers, especially smaller operators and those in developing markets. This situation often results in extended evaluation periods and reluctance to make procurement decisions, which can hinder market entry and slow the adoption of new technologies. With a heightened sensitivity to costs, many operators may continue to depend on outdated equipment instead of investing in modern solutions. Furthermore, organizations frequently emphasize core operational expenses, which can divert financial resources away from peripheral monitoring technologies and ultimately hamper overall market growth until more affordable financing options and cost-effective alternatives become available.
Market Trends of the Global Anemometer Market
The Global Anemometer market is witnessing a significant shift driven by the integration of IoT technology, leading to a surge in demand for advanced anemometers capable of real-time data transmission. Manufacturers are increasingly developing devices equipped with low-power communication capabilities, allowing for remote monitoring of wind conditions in diverse environments, from agricultural settings to urban landscapes and offshore installations. This trend not only enhances predictive maintenance and forecasting accuracy but also fosters the integration of wind data into broader environmental analysis, creating a competitive edge for companies offering interoperable and upgradeable solutions. As users seek enhanced data connectivity and actionable insights, the market continues to evolve rapidly.
